For one reason or another, angelology has become the proverbial redheaded stepchild of systematic theology classes and books.1 Though angelology is not the most important doctrine in the Scriptures, it is an important doctrine nonetheless. Angels are referenced in the Scriptures no less than 300 times.  There is essentially two types of angels; elect and evil. This paper will primarily focus in on the elect side of angels to the neglect of the evil angels. There will at times be many things that crossover between elect and evil, but the primary scope of this paper will be toward elect angels.

Perhaps ones time could be better spent studying some other aspect of theology, but this paper will show why and how important the study of angels are and how they integrate into other parts of theology. The first and foremost reason why one studies this topic, is to gain insight into the wonders of God’s person, power and program.2 Pertaining specifically to angelology, understanding the nature and activities of the spirit world will increase ones appreciation of a sovereign God whose creative ability, control of the universe, and interventions on our behalf assure His glory and the elect’s greater good.
The study of angels also magnifies the grace of God. God could judge all at once, but He patiently delays.  And, out of the midst of wicked men influenced by Satan and demons, He rescues all who trust in Jesus Christ and delivers them from demonic power right now.  One day, in righteousness and grace, He will establish a new heaven and new earth in which Satan and demons will have no more influence and the occult will be dead.
